James David Cain violated the restrictions on the use of campaign funds in the CFDA when he used campaign funds for a personal use unrelated to the holding of or seeking of public office.

1 <br /> LOUISIANA BOARD OF ETHICS <br /> DATE: September 30,2009 OPINION NO.: 2007-787 <br /> RE: In the Matter of James David Cain <br /> The Louisiana Board of Ethics("the Board"),in its capacity as the Supervisory Committee <br /> on Campaign Finance Disclosure, pursuant to the authority contained in LSA-R.S. 18:1511.4, <br /> conducted a confidential investigation concerning information that revealed that James David Cain, <br /> a candidate for State Representative,District 32 in the October 20,2007 election,may have violated <br /> provisions of the Campaign Finance Disclosure Act by using campaign funds for a personal use <br /> unrelated to the holding of public office. Section 1505.2I prohibits the use of campaign funds for a <br /> personal use unrelated to a political campaign. <br /> On the basis of information obtained during the investigation, and with the concurrence of <br /> 410 James David Cain, the Board now makes the following: <br /> I. <br /> FINDINGS OF FACT <br /> 1. <br /> James David Cain was a candidate for State Representative, District 32 in the October 20, <br /> 2007 and November 7,2007 elections. <br /> 2. <br /> On Mr. Cain's thirtieth day prior to the primary(30-P)campaign finance disclosure report, <br /> filed on September 19, 2007,he disclosed the following expenditures: <br /> - a$100 donation on January 22, 2007 to Garrett Green, donation for La. College mission <br /> trip <br />
